Output 10c81fd0a80ec3cb92ed7f8cc83b3a292efb8bfde0e006dd4a4be5afa27deced:120

value
21740
script pubkey
OP_0 OP_PUSHBYTES_20 25fb1fa8a51a2898159c58631ea16a5c9ebbb9c1
address
bc1qyha3l299rg5fs9vutp33agt2tj0thwwp35496a
transaction
10c81fd0a80ec3cb92ed7f8cc83b3a292efb8bfde0e006dd4a4be5afa27deced
spent
true